Understanding the Basics
Let’s start with the fundamentals. Online casinos are essentially digital versions of traditional brick-and-mortar casinos. They operate through websites or apps, allowing you to play casino games using your computer, smartphone, or tablet. You’ll typically need to create an account, deposit funds, and then you can start playing.
The games themselves are often the same as those you’d find in a physical casino, including:
- Pokies (Slots): These are the most popular games, known for their simplicity and exciting bonus features. They involve spinning reels with various symbols, aiming to match winning combinations.
- Blackjack: A card game where you try to beat the dealer by getting a hand as close to 21 as possible without going over.
- Roulette: A game of chance where you bet on where a ball will land on a spinning wheel.
- Baccarat: Another card game where you bet on the player, the banker, or a tie.
- Poker: Various poker games are available, from Texas Hold’em to Omaha, where you compete against other players.

Understanding Bonuses and Promotions
Online casinos often offer bonuses and promotions to attract new players and reward existing ones. These can include:
- Welcome Bonuses: Offered to new players, often matching a percentage of your initial deposit.
- No Deposit Bonuses: Give you free spins or bonus funds without requiring a deposit.
- Free Spins: Awarded on specific slot games.
- Reload Bonuses: Offered to existing players when they make subsequent deposits.
- Loyalty Programs: Reward players with points or other benefits based on their activity.
Always read the terms and conditions of any bonus offer carefully. Pay attention to wagering requirements (how many times you need to play through the bonus amount before you can withdraw winnings), game restrictions, and expiry dates.
Responsible Gambling
Responsible gambling is paramount. Online gambling should be a form of entertainment, not a source of financial stress. Here’s how to gamble responsibly:
- Set a Budget: Decide how much you can afford to spend and stick to it. Never chase losses.
- Set Time Limits: Decide how long you will play for each session.
- Use Self-Exclusion Tools: Most casinos offer tools to limit your deposits, losses, and playing time. You can also self-exclude yourself from gambling for a set period.
- Recognize the Signs of Problem Gambling: If you find yourself gambling more than you intended, spending more money than you can afford, or neglecting other responsibilities, seek help.
- Seek Support: If you need help, reach out to organisations like Gambling Help Online or Lifeline.
